Inclusion criteria

Inclusion criteria: 1) a clinical diagnosis of SMA type II, IIIa, IIIb, IV, and a genetically confirmed homozygous SMN1 deletion 2) given oral and written informed consent when *18 years old; 3) given informed consent by the parents or legal representative and the patient in case of patients aged *12 till

Exclusion criteria

Exclusion criteria: 1) Severe SMA, defined as clinical types 0 and I; 2) Inability to meet study visits 3) Total tube feeding

Design outcomes

Primary

MeasureTime frame
a. VFSS: Feeding and swallowing problems are investigated in the oral transit phase, the pharyngeal phase and upper oesophageal phase of swallowing, using VFSS, with primary endpoints: Formation of bolus pureed food (yes/no); duration of oral transit phase in liquids (sec.); piece meal deglutition (yes/no); laryngeal aspiration/penetration (8-point scale);post-swallow residue in the hypopharynx (score 1-6); reduced UES opening (yes/no) and premature closure UES (yes /no). Two independent raters will observe the video of the VFSS (15% of the total amount of VFSS, randomly chosen) and data will compared to assess interrater reliability. b. Timed Water Swallowing test (TWST), outcome measures: ml/sec (comparisons with normal values)(J.G.Kalf, 2011; Nathadwarawala, 1992) Two independent raters will score this test (15% of the total amount, randomly chosen) and data will compared to assess interrater reliability. c. Swallowing Volume Test (SVT), outcome measures: max ml water swallowed in one swallow (comparisons with normal values) (Ertekin C, 1996; J.G.Kalf, 2011). Two independent raters will score this test (15% of the total amount, randomly chosen) and data will compared to assess interrater reliability. d. Test for Observation of Mastication and Swallowing Solids (TOMASS), outcome measures: number of discrete bites, masticatory cycles, swallows, total time (comparisons with normal values, ML Huckabee et al). Two independent raters will observe the video of performance of this test (15% of the total amount, randomly chosen) and data will compared to assess interrater reliability. e. Six minute mastication test (endurance) (6MMT), outcome measures: total amount of chewing cycles and the difference between minute 1 (M1) and minute 6 (M2) (data are compared with normal values using z-scores, van den Engel-Hoek et al, 2017).
